Handover: Exportron retry queue

Hi Mira — handing over the failed-export retries. Exports that hit a timeout land in the retry queue and get three attempts with backoff; after that they're parked and need a manual requeue from the admin panel. Watch for customers reporting duplicates — that usually means a double requeue. The current retry settings are as follows.

settings of bajog-fawig:
oliael:
  log_level: warn
  metrics_host: metrics.oliael.zemvarsys.internal
  pin: 0267
  pool_size: 32

Subject: Quickstore 4.2 — bloom filter now fronts the KV layer

Plugin authors: starting with this release, Quickstore places a bloom filter ahead of the key-value store. Negative lookups return faster; false positives fall through safely. No API changes are required on your side. Verify your plugin against the staging build referenced below.

session token of fahif-tadup = htk3_9c7

**Ticket: LEX-4410 — extraction script failing with 401s**

Hey plugin folks — heads up that the Stringsift extraction script stopped pulling translation catalogs from the Phraseloom backend last night. Turns out the shared credential we'd baked into the sample config expired over the weekend, so every `stringsift pull` now bombs out with an auth error. We've minted a fresh credential for the internal Phraseloom catalog service, and you'll want to drop it into your config. The replacement key follows immediately below.

app token of kajop-tahag = qvz23-qaEp6MzrfP2AwhVbZwsZeUq